Do you still wrap your books?
By youless
@youless (112724)
Guangzhou, China
May 18, 2021 8:32am CST
When I was a student long time ago, I used to wrap my books so that they would keep well. And I use the calendar paper to wrap the books and it was environmental. Today it seems it is less important to wrap the books. And it is common for people to buy the plastic book wrapping.
